Police: Dozens of cars broken into overnight in Bensonhurst
More than a dozen car owners in Bensonhurst woke up to find their cars broken into Tuesday morning.
Police say the suspects apparently targeted cars along Bath Avenue, Bay 40th Street and Bay 41st Street.
Stephanie Francoforte says she owns one of the cars that were broken into.

"It's just upsetting. It's two weeks old, this is my brand-new car. I work hard and some children are obviously jealous and targeted it,” says Francoforte.

Surveillance video from one home on the block shows two people with hoodies on banging up against one of the cars.
The suspects are seen smashing car windows and rummaging through the cars.
Francoforte says they didn't steal any items from her car, but her neighbor was robbed of $20.

Neighbors tell News 12 they are grateful no one was hurt, but say they're definitely shaken up by it all.

"Other than being upset, I feel violated, this is my car, this is my property. I work hard and to come out and see this, it's disturbing it doesn't make me feel comfortable in my own neighborhood,” says Francoforte.

Anyone with information is asked to call police.
